The best way to get the CFI job you want is to train at that school. At least do your CFI there, since they prefer to hire their own customers (who also know their procedures).

There are several things to look for in a school to work at...

1) Close to home if possible
2) Good reputation as an employer...ie no jerk managers or pressure to break FARs.
3) Conducts ME training so you can get your twin time without paying for it.

If your training is already done, the best way to get a job would be to network with whoever you know in your local GA scene. Otherwise print out some resumes, put on slacks, shirt, and tie and go door to door at every GA operator in your area.

If that doesn't work, find out what the experience requirements are to freelance at the local clubs and FBOs. Freelance requires initiative because you have to find up your own students, but you can charge more. Once you get established, additional students will usually find you by word of mouth. Of course you have to withold your own taxes each quarter, and maybe get a business license.
